SMU-CX1 is a selective TLR3 inhibitor with an IC50 of 0.11 μM, demonstrating effective inhibition across various influenza A virus subtypes, with IC50 values ranging from 0.14 to 0.33 μM. Additionally, SMU-CX1 shows antiviral activity against SARS-CoV-2, targeting viral PB2 and NP proteins with an IC50 of 0.43 μM. Furthermore, SMU-CX1 modulates the inflammatory response in host cells by inhibiting key factors such as IFN-β, IP-10, and CCL-5, making it a valuable tool for research in virology and innate immune response.
